is a French national park in the departments of and . The park is the Ecrins mountain range, which is in the French Alps bordered to the south by the Durance valley, to the north by the Romanche valley, and to the west by the Drac and Buech valleys.

Peak
The is a mountain in the with a peak elevation of 4,102 metres. It is the highest peak of the and the and the most southerly alpine peak in Europe that is higher than 4,000 metres.
